The Benefits of One Hour of Daily Exercise for Health
In today’s fast-paced world, many people lead sedentary lifestyles, which can have negative consequences for health. Engaging in just one hour of exercise each day can significantly improve overall well-being. Regular physical activity has been proven to boost physical health, mental clarity, and emotional balance. Whether it’s a brisk walk, jog, yoga, or cycling, dedicating an hour each day can bring immense long-term benefits.
Improved Cardiovascular Health
Exercising for an hour a day helps strengthen the heart, reducing the risk of heart disease and stroke. Physical activities like running, swimming, or cycling increase heart rate and improve blood circulation, lowering blood pressure and cholesterol levels. These activities also help maintain a healthy weight, further reducing the risk of cardiovascular issues.
Enhanced Mental Health
Regular physical activity has profound benefits for mental well-being. Exercise triggers the release of endorphins, which are known as “feel-good” hormones. This helps combat stress, anxiety, and depression. Engaging in exercise daily for an hour can provide clarity of mind, increase focus, and even improve sleep patterns, making it easier to handle daily challenges.
Weight Management and Increased Metabolism
One of the key benefits of daily exercise is weight management. Physical activity burns calories, which helps with fat loss and muscle toning. An increased metabolism due to regular exercise helps the body utilize nutrients more efficiently, leading to better energy levels and maintaining a healthy body composition.
Strengthened Immune System
Regular exercise enhances the immune system, making the body more resilient to infections and illnesses. An active lifestyle encourages the circulation of white blood cells and improves lymphatic function, helping the body ward off illnesses more effectively. Just one hour of exercise each day can keep you healthier and less prone to common colds and other ailments.
Improved Longevity
Studies show that people who engage in regular exercise live longer, healthier lives. Exercise slows down the aging process by improving muscle mass, bone density, and flexibility. It also reduces the risk of chronic diseases like type 2 diabetes, which can shorten life expectancy. An hour of exercise a day can extend both the quality and quantity of life.
